基于GPU的骨骼动画引擎的研究与实现.docx
快乐****蜜蜂
在线预览结束,喜欢就下载吧,查找使用更方便
相关资料
基于GPU的骨骼动画引擎的研究与实现.docx
基于GPU的骨骼动画引擎的研究与实现摘要:随着计算机的不断发展,GPU逐渐成为计算机中一个重要的计算单元。骨骼动画是计算机图形学中的一个重要研究方向,GPU骨骼动画引擎是近年来新兴的研究领域。本文主要研究GPU骨骼动画引擎的实现原理、技术、优化策略以及其在游戏开发和虚拟现实领域的应用。通过在GPU上实现骨骼动画引擎可以提升渲染效率和运行速度,从而提升用户的使用体验。本文的研究结果对于计算机图形学领域和游戏开发领域的技术人员和研究者具有一定的指导意义。关键词:GPU,骨骼动画,引擎,优化策略,应用一、引言骨
基于GPU的骨骼动画引擎的研究与实现的任务书.docx
基于GPU的骨骼动画引擎的研究与实现的任务书任务书1.研究目标骨骼动画引擎是一种基于计算机图形学的技术,可以通过对骨骼的控制实现模型的动态变化。在实时计算场景中,骨骼动画引擎需要具备高效的性能和良好的渲染效果,才能满足各种复杂应用场景的需求。本次研究主要目标是设计并实现一款基于GPU的骨骼动画引擎,使其具备以下特点:1.高效的计算性能:基于GPU的骨骼动画引擎具备更高效的计算性能,可以实现更快的帧速率和更流畅的动画效果。2.灵活的动画控制:骨骼动画引擎需要具备良好的动画控制能力,可以根据用户需求实现多样化
基于HLSL的渐变动画GPU实现.docx
基于HLSL的渐变动画GPU实现基于HLSL的渐变动画GPU实现摘要:本文基于High-LevelShaderLanguage(HLSL),介绍了渐变动画在图形处理单元(GPU)上的实现方式。首先,通过渐变动画的定义和原理给出了GPU渐变动画实现的基本思路。然后,详细介绍了HLSL的概念和基本语法。接着,讨论了渐变动画GPU实现的流程,包括顶点和像素着色器的编写以及渐变动画的参数传递等。最后,通过对比实验,证明了GPU渐变动画相较于CPU实现具有更高的效率和性能。关键词:HLSL、渐变动画、GPU、顶点着
骨骼动画技术的研究与实现.docx
骨骼动画技术的研究与实现骨骼动画技术的研究与实现骨骼动画技术是计算机动画中的一项重要技术,被广泛应用于电影、游戏等领域。它利用骨骼系统对角色进行建模,通过对骨骼系统的操作和控制,实现角色的动画效果。本文将从骨骼动画技术的原理、算法和实现等方面进行探讨。一、骨骼动画技术原理骨骼动画技术采用骨骼系统对角色进行建模,骨骼系统由多个骨骼节点和连接器组成,节点和连接器共同构成了一个骨骼层次结构。每个骨骼节点都有其自身的坐标系,包括位置、旋转和缩放等属性,节点之间通过连接器进行连接,连接器也可以进行旋转和缩放等操作。
骨骼动画技术的研究与实现的中期报告.docx
骨骼动画技术的研究与实现的中期报告1.研究背景与意义骨骼动画是一种将3D模型作为一个有机整体进行动态变化的技术,是现代计算机图形学中最为常用的一种动画制作方法。在游戏、电影、虚拟现实等领域中得到了广泛应用。本研究旨在探究骨骼动画技术的原理、方法和实现,并在此基础上,尝试优化骨骼动画的效果和运行性能,为相关应用提供支持。2.研究内容(1)骨骼动画的基本原理和方法。(2)现有的骨骼动画算法及其优缺点。(3)采用C++编程语言来实现基于骨骼动画的动画系统。(4)优化骨骼动画的效果和运行性能,以提升应用体验。3.